Importance of Elderly Care Support

As individuals age, maintaining independence becomes increasingly challenging due to physical limitations, chronic conditions, or cognitive changes, making quality elderly care essential for overall health and happiness. In San Diego County and Temecula, California, where many seniors prefer aging in place, supportive services help prevent isolation, reduce fall risks, and manage daily routines effectively. Elderly care addresses key areas like personal hygiene, nutrition, mobility, and social engagement, which are crucial for preventing complications such as malnutrition, depression, or injuries from household tasks. By providing consistent assistance with bathing, dressing, meal preparation, and housekeeping, it allows seniors to stay in familiar environments longer, avoiding the stress of relocation to facilities. Moreover, incorporating active living elements—like light exercises, hobbies, or gardening—boosts physical strength, mental sharpness, and emotional well-being, combating issues like muscle weakness or anxiety. For those with diabetes or progressive diseases, specialized routines such as foot care or medication reminders prevent severe complications like infections or ulcers. Ultimately, elderly care not only extends lifespan but also enhances life quality, offering families peace of mind through coordinated support that adapts to evolving needs, ensuring seniors remain active, safe, and connected within their communities.

How We Help With Elderly Care

 We create personalized care plans that assist with essential daily activities under the Health and Safety Code, including bathing, dressing, toileting, incontinence care, feeding, meal planning and preparation, exercising, positioning, transferring, ambulating, housekeeping, laundry, shopping, transportation, companionship, making telephone calls, and medication assistance. For custodial needs, we support routine personal tasks and mobility supervision to maintain independence and prevent accidents. Personal care focuses on grooming, hygiene, and dignity-preserving routines like proper nail trimming to avoid ingrown nails or infections, especially for diabetics, through daily foot inspections, cleaning, and monitoring for redness or swelling. Active living services encourage engagement in hobbies, light exercises, social conversations, and community involvement, such as gardening for stress relief—planting herbs, watering plants, or light pruning—to improve flexibility, circulation, muscle strength, and mindfulness while reducing anxiety. Care management oversees all aspects, creating plans, monitoring delivery, and communicating with families or professionals using technology like digital scheduling, electronic health records (EHR), mobile apps for updates, and medication tracking tools to ensure compliance, accuracy, and timely adjustments. For ventilator-dependent or progressive conditions, we provide structured support and referrals when skilled nursing is needed, always promoting nutrition, hydration, and emotional well-being to enhance daily living and prevent hospitalizations.
